Cajun-spiced prawns

Total time: 30 min • Prep: 15 min • Cook: 15 min • Serves: 4 • Difficulty: Easy


Ingredients
Paprika
½ teaspoon(s), level
Oregano, Dried
½ teaspoon(s), level
Salt
¼ teaspoon(s)
Cayenne Pepper
¼ teaspoon(s), level
Black pepper
¼ teaspoon(s)
King Prawns, Raw
300 g
Olive Oil
1½ tablespoon(s)
Onion
1 large
Garlic
1 clove(s)
Yellow pepper
2 medium
Green pepper
1 medium
Parsley, fresh
2 tablespoon(s)
Lemon
½ medium
Instructions
1
In a small bowl, mix together the paprika, oregano, salt, cayenne pepper and black pepper. Toss half the spice mixture with the prawns and set aside.
2
Heat 1 tbsp of the oil in a frying pan over a medium-high heat. Add the onion and cook for 3 minutes until softened. Add the garlic and cook for a further minute. Add the peppers, and the remaining spice mixture, cook for 4 -5 minutes until lightly golden and tender. Transfer mixture to a bowl, cover and set aside.
3
Using the same pan, add the remaining oil and place over a medium-high heat. Add the prawns in a single layer. Cook for 4 minutes, turning halfway through, until prawns are cooked. Add the pepper mixture to the pan and toss to combine and heat through.
4
Serve with the parsley sprinkled over the prawns and lemon wedges on the side.
